Transaction 44ec86917c7a1e967533c8f788b3f16372f78d1e94b6dea3f362d9d07477e01f

1 Input
2 Outputs
  • 44ec86917c7a1e967533c8f788b3f16372f78d1e94b6dea3f362d9d07477e01f:0
  • value  72545
    address  16Phc713RpZnjHBM3jjzCgm8FTeTUz3gF2
  • 44ec86917c7a1e967533c8f788b3f16372f78d1e94b6dea3f362d9d07477e01f:1
  • value  3495935
    address  36hXiaxySDNsHUkV7TxSFHL6BdMfsh3Vs4